Ev. Luth. Christopherus Kirche
Located in Hannover, the Ev. Luth. Christopherus Kirche reflects contemporary ecclesiastical architecture and community outreach.
Founded in 1964 by the Lutheran community, this church serves as a cultural hub for local events. Its minimalistic architecture is characterized by large stained-glass windows that illuminate the interior, creating an inviting atmosphere for congregation and visitors alike.
